Autoplay
Autocomplete
Previous Lesson
Complete and Continue
The Complete iOS SDK Development
One Signal
1. Create push notification app xcode project 1 (2:58)
2. Register account and create a new app 1 (2:03)
3.Create a p12 certificate and upload 1 (8:10)
4. Install the SDK and set up the code 1 (5:57)
5.initialise one signal with app id and run on device 1 (3:25)
6. send push from one signal dashboard 1 (2:32)
7. send push notification from the app 1 (4:18)
8. Get user player id by code 1 (1:48)
LinkedIn
1. Create Xcode project (3:49)
2. Create new app on linkedin website (3:35)
3. Install SDK and add info plist information (6:11)
4 Present the login screen and get access token (5:24)
5. Get user profile information (5:03)
6. Display user_s information and photo on the app once logged in (7:14)
7. Add a function to redirect user if linkedin app is used for authentication (2:42)
Google Signin
1. Create xcode project for google login app-EDITED 1 (2:16)
2. Install google sign in sdk and create an oauth client id-EDITED 1 (4:49)
3. Implement the app sign in delegate functions-EDITED 1 (6:19)
4.Present the login user interface and log in the user-EDITED 1 (3:58)
Foursquare API
1. create xcode project (3:16)
2. Create a new app to get app id and secret (1:58)
3. Install foursquare api client library using cocoapods (2:16)
4. Make client api request (5:48)
5. Display data as json object (2:32)
6. get access to the name key and venue id (4:08)
7. Make a photo api request with venue ID (4:49)
8. Display the photo using the prefix and suffix keys (6:29)
Firebase Storage
1. Create xcode project (4:22)
2. Create new project on console, Install Firebase Storage SDK and complete all set up (6:29)
3.Firebase file upload implementation (7:44)
4. Firebase storage security rules (4:49)
5. Firebase data download implementation (5:29)
6. Download file using the URL (3:33)
7. Navigating folders and subfolders in your storage bucket (4:29)
Firebase Authentication
1. Create xcode project for the app (8:37)
2. Create new app, install sdk, add plist and complete set up (6:09)
3 register a user in the app (7:34)
4. Check to see if a user is logged out or logged in (3:33)
5. Logout the user (2:20)
6. Login a new user (3:59)
Facebook Login
1. Set up the app xcode project (4:31)
2.Initialise project with cocoapods (2:28)
3.Create app on facebook developer website (7:06)
4.present the login window and attempt login (6:20)
5 Make Graph API request to get profile information (6:41)
6. Display users name and profile picture (7:15)
7.Request higher quality photo and make the app public (2:09)
Dropbox SDK
1. Create xcode project (4:01)
2. Create new app id and install sdk (3:20)
3. Initialise the project and set up plist (2:58)
4. Present dropbox login and check authentication result (5:40)
5. Upload photo to dropbox folder (6:35)
6. Download a file from dropbox folder (5:44)
7. Create new folder and create right paths for downloads (4:25)
Crashlytics SDK
1. Create crashable app xcode project-EDITED 1 (3:40)
2. Set up crashlytics sdk anc configuration-EDITED 1 (6:46)
3.Register a crash on the dashboard-EDITED 1 (4:56)
4.Create 4 crashes from the app-EDITED 1 (6:16)
Cocoapods Installation
1.What is cocoapods (2:29)
2.Install cocoapods on the mac (2:35)
3.Initialise xcode project with cocoapods (3:04)
4. install 3 pod projects (7:10)
5.Useful cocoapods commands (2:45)
Braintree SDK
1. Create xcode project and install the sdk 1 (3:48)
2.Present the drop in UI and register sandbox account 1 (5:18)
3. Set up simple PHP server on lightsail 1 (9:15)
4. Process payment on the client 1 (7:57)
5.Accepting paypal payment 1 (6:16)
Amazon S3 SDK
1. Create amazon s3 xcode project-EDITED 1 (7:01)
2. Install AWS SDK and add the ATS settings-EDITED 1 (3:44)
3. Cognito, S3 and IAM set up-EDITED 1 (7:31)
4. Upload photo to S3-EDITED 1 (7:55)
5. Download date from S3 bucket-EDITED 1 (5:02)
AdMob SDK
1.Create xcode project for the admob app-EDITED 1 (2:52)
2. Install the SDK with cocoapods and initialise the project-EDITED 1 (3:10)
3.Create a new app to get an ADMOB app Id-EDITED 1 (1:54)
4. show banner ads-EDITED 1 (8:11)
5. Show interstitial ad-EDITED 1 (6:22)
6. Interstitial ad delegate functions-EDITED 1 (3:19)
Intro Videos
admob-intro 1 (1:14)
facebook intro 1 (1:25)
parse-intro 1 (1:30)
firebase-storage-intro 1 (1:24)
google-signin-intro 1 (1:06)
dropbox-intro 1 (1:28)
onesignal-intro 1 (1:26)
conclusion-edited (0:57)
twitter-intro 1 (1:09)
firebase-login-intro 1 (1:17)
amazon-intro 1 (1:17)
crashlytics-intro 1 (1:17)
braintree-intro 1 (1:27)
linkedin-intro 1 (1:24)
foursuare-intro 1 (1:21)
foursuare-intro 1
Lesson content locked
If you're already enrolled,
you'll need to login
.
Enroll in Course to Unlock